Searched refs:SrcEvaluatorType (Results 1 - 5 of 5) sorted by relevance
/external/eigen/Eigen/src/SparseCore/ |
H A D | SparseAssign.h | 75 typedef internal::evaluator<SrcXprType> SrcEvaluatorType; typedef 77 SrcEvaluatorType srcEvaluator(src); 79 const bool transpose = (DstEvaluatorType::Flags & RowMajorBit) != (SrcEvaluatorType::Flags & RowMajorBit); 80 const Index outerEvaluationSize = (SrcEvaluatorType::Flags&RowMajorBit) ? src.rows() : src.cols(); 90 for (typename SrcEvaluatorType::InnerIterator it(srcEvaluator, j); it; ++it) 102 (!((DstEvaluatorType::Flags & RowMajorBit) != (SrcEvaluatorType::Flags & RowMajorBit)))) && 105 enum { Flip = (DstEvaluatorType::Flags & RowMajorBit) != (SrcEvaluatorType::Flags & RowMajorBit) }; 114 for (typename SrcEvaluatorType::InnerIterator it(srcEvaluator, j); it; ++it)
|
H A D | SparseVector.h | 444 typedef internal::evaluator<Src> SrcEvaluatorType; typedef 445 SrcEvaluatorType srcEval(src); 446 for(typename SrcEvaluatorType::InnerIterator it(srcEval, 0); it; ++it) 455 typedef internal::evaluator<Src> SrcEvaluatorType; typedef 456 SrcEvaluatorType srcEval(src); 459 typename SrcEvaluatorType::InnerIterator it(srcEval, i);
|
/external/eigen/Eigen/src/Core/ |
H A D | SelfAdjointView.h | 290 typedef typename Base::SrcEvaluatorType SrcEvaluatorType; typedef in class:Eigen::internal::triangular_dense_assignment_kernel 295 EIGEN_DEVICE_FUNC triangular_dense_assignment_kernel(DstEvaluatorType &dst, const SrcEvaluatorType &src, const Functor &func, DstXprType& dstExpr)
|
H A D | TriangularMatrix.h | 748 typedef typename Base::SrcEvaluatorType SrcEvaluatorType; typedef in class:Eigen::internal::triangular_dense_assignment_kernel 753 EIGEN_DEVICE_FUNC triangular_dense_assignment_kernel(DstEvaluatorType &dst, const SrcEvaluatorType &src, const Functor &func, DstXprType& dstExpr) 787 typedef evaluator<SrcXprType> SrcEvaluatorType; typedef 789 SrcEvaluatorType srcEvaluator(src); 798 DstEvaluatorType,SrcEvaluatorType,Functor> Kernel; 803 && SrcEvaluatorType::CoeffReadCost < HugeCost 804 && DstXprType::SizeAtCompileTime * (DstEvaluatorType::CoeffReadCost+SrcEvaluatorType::CoeffReadCost) / 2 <= EIGEN_UNROLLING_LIMIT
|
H A D | AssignEvaluator.h | 604 typedef SrcEvaluatorTypeT SrcEvaluatorType; typedef in class:Eigen::internal::generic_dense_assignment_kernel 610 EIGEN_DEVICE_FUNC generic_dense_assignment_kernel(DstEvaluatorType &dst, const SrcEvaluatorType &src, const Functor &func, DstXprType& dstExpr) 626 EIGEN_DEVICE_FUNC const SrcEvaluatorType& srcEvaluator() const { return m_src; } 694 const SrcEvaluatorType& m_src; 728 typedef evaluator<SrcXprType> SrcEvaluatorType; typedef 730 SrcEvaluatorType srcEvaluator(src); 738 typedef generic_dense_assignment_kernel<DstEvaluatorType,SrcEvaluatorType,Functor> Kernel;
|
Completed in 263 milliseconds